Maryland Insurance Requirements

Minimum Coverage Requirements

Liability Limits30/60/15
Fault SystemAt-Fault (Tort)
PIP RequiredYes
UM/UIM RequiredYes

Important Legal Notes

  • Uses strict contributory negligence rule
  • ANY fault bars recovery from other party
  • PIP minimum of $2,500 required
  • UM coverage required at minimum limits

Common Home Insurance Gaps in MD

Flood & Water Damage

Most homeowners policies exclude flood damage, requiring separate coverage.

Potential Loss: $50,000 - $200,000+

Sewer Backup

Sewer and drain backup is typically excluded but easily added as an endorsement.

Potential Loss: $10,000 - $50,000

Home Office Equipment

Business equipment at home often has limited coverage under standard policies.

Potential Loss: $5,000 - $20,000

What's the difference between ACV and replacement cost?

Actual Cash Value (ACV) pays what your items were worth at the time of loss (depreciated value), while Replacement Cost pays what it costs to buy new items. Replacement cost provides significantly better protection.

Does home insurance cover flooding?

Standard homeowners insurance policies do NOT cover flood damage. You need a separate flood insurance policy, typically through FEMA's National Flood Insurance Program or a private insurer.
